    Default Can't Save SHSH Blog for iPhone 4

    I have an iphone 4 on v4.3.5. I am planning to updating to iOS 5, but before I do so, I want to save the SHSH blobs using Tiny Umbrella. I used Tiny Umbrella, but it is not saving the SHSH blobs...

    If you don't have 4.3.5 shsh blob saved, then you won't be able to downgrade.
    If you are still at 4.3.5 and iphone is still bootable, you can run ifaith and dump your 4.3.5 shsh blob to be used for future downgrade.

    Never mind I fixed the issue. After I got error after failure with 4.3.5 installion, I was stuck in recovery mode. I used redsn0w to kick me out of recovery, and it turns out iPhone 4 booted into v4.3.5 with clean installation. So it suceeded, I just had to kick out of the recovery mode using redsn0w.
